How to show more selected fields on dashboard event panel

I have a dashboard I've created to explore XML trace transactions, it works fine, but when trying to find specific parts of the transaction I have to open each event and check if its the correct part, to make it easier I want to be able to include extra selected fields to show the description of the xml event.

I have extracted this field, but cant get it to show on the dashboard, it shows correctly when viewing it in search.

Query is sourcetype=[sourcetype] Description=* ActivityID=[activityid]

add this to your dashboard:

<fields>Description, host, source, sourcetype</fields>

See here for example:

http://docs.splunk.com/Documentation/Splunk/7.0.0/Viz/PanelreferenceforSimplifiedXML#event
